Description
This recipe details how to make a creamy potato soup.
Ingredients
- 2 tablespoons butter
- 1 cup chopped onion
- 1 cup chopped celery
- 1 clove garlic, minced
- 8 cups peeled and diced potatoes
- 6 cups chicken broth
- 1 teaspoon salt
- ½ teaspoon ground black pepper
- 1 cup half-and-half
- ½ cup shredded Cheddar cheese
- 2 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ley (optional)
Instructions
- Melt butter in a large pot over medium heat. Add onion, celery, and garlic; cook until softened, about 5 minutes.
- Stir in potatoes, chicken broth, salt, and pepper.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er until potatoes are tender, about 15-20 minutes.
- Use an immersion blender to blend a portion of the soup until creamy, leaving some potato chunks for texture.
- Stir in half-and-half and Cheddar cheese. Cook until heated through and cheese is melted, about 5 minutes.
- Garnish with fresh parsley, if desired, before serving.
Notes
- For a thicker soup, mash more of the potatoes.
- Adjust salt and pepper to taste.
- This soup can be made ahead and reheated.
